在数字化时代,安卓应用的安全问题日益受到**。尤其是安卓AK文件,由于其开放性,很容易被恶意篡改。学习如何对安卓AK进行加密,对于保护应用的安全至关重要。**将详细阐述安卓AK加密的方法和步骤,帮助开发者们更好地保护自己的应用。
一、了解AK加密的重要性
1.保护应用不被篡改
2.防止应用被逆向工程
3.保护用户数据安全二、选择合适的加密工具
1.使用AndroidStudio自带的roGuard工具进行混淆
2.使用第三方加密库,如Xosed、VXTool等
3.使用混淆工具结合代码加密,如Ofuscator、Aktool等三、使用roGuard进行混淆
1.在AndroidStudio中打开roGuard配置文件
2.配置混淆规则,如压缩、优化、混淆等
3.运行roGuard进行混淆处理四、使用第三方加密库进行加密
1.在项目的uild.gradle文件中添加依赖
2.根据库的文档,配置加密参数
3.在代码中调用加密方法,对AK进行加密五、使用混淆工具结合代码加密
1.使用混淆工具对AK进行混淆
2.使用代码加密工具对关键代码进行加密
3.将混淆和加密后的AK打包发布六、测试加密后的AK
1.使用模拟器或真机测试加密后的应用
2.确认应用功能正常,且加密效果达到预期
3.如果有问题,返回上一步进行调整七、注意加密过程中的安全问题
1.避免在加密过程中泄露敏感信息
2.定期更新加密算法和工具,提高安全性
3.监控应用运行情况,及时发现并处理安全问题 通过以上步骤,我们可以对安卓AK进行有效的加密,提高应用的安全性。在实际操作中,开发者应根据自身需求选择合适的加密方法和工具,并在加密过程中注意安全风险。 随着技术的不断发展,AK加密的方法和工具也在不断更新。未来,我们将继续**AK加密领域的新动态,为大家提供更多实用技巧和经验分享。**详细介绍了安卓AK加密的方法和步骤,帮助开发者们更好地保护自己的应用。通过合理配置加密工具和加密参数,我们可以有效提高AK的安全性,为用户提供更安全的软件体验。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。